Zuppa Toscana Soup
Zuppa Toscana, a beloved Italian soup, combines savory sausage, fresh kale, and tender potatoes in a creamy broth. Ingredients
– 1 lb Italian sausage (spicy or mild)
– 4 cups chicken broth
– 2 cups kale, chopped
– 2 large potatoes, diced
– 1 cup heavy cream
– 1 onion, chopped
– 3 cloves garlic, minced
– 1 tsp red pepper flakes (optional)
– Salt and pepper to taste
– Olive oil for cooking
Servings and Cooking Time
This recipe serves 6 people. Preparation time is approximately 15 minutes, and cooking time is about 30 minutes.
Nutritional Value
Each serving of Zuppa Toscana soup (1 cup) contains approximately 350 calories, 20g fat, 25g carbohydrates, and 15g protein. This is based on a standard serving size for one person.
Step-by-Step Cooking Process
1. In a large pot, heat olive oil over medium heat.
2. Add chopped onion and sauté until translucent.
3. Stir in minced garlic and red pepper flakes, cooking for an additional minute.
4. Add Italian sausage, breaking it apart with a spoon, and cook until browned.
5. Pour in chicken broth and bring to a boil.
6. Add diced potatoes and cook until tender, about 10-15 minutes.
7. Stir in chopped kale and simmer for another 5 minutes.
8. Reduce heat and incorporate heavy cream, mixing well.
9. Season with salt and pepper to taste.
10. Serve hot, garnished with fresh herbs if desired.
Alternative Ingredients
You can easily substitute Italian sausage with turkey or chicken sausage for a lighter version. Additionally, for a vegetarian option, use vegetable broth and omit the sausage altogether while adding more vegetables like carrots or bell peppers.

Storage and Reheating
Store leftover Zuppa Toscana in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days. To reheat, warm it on the stove over medium heat, adding a splash of broth if needed. This soup can be frozen for up to 3 months; however, the cream may change in texture upon reheating.
Cooking Mistakes
– Don’t skip browning the sausage for better flavor.
– Avoid overcooking the potatoes; they should be tender but not mushy.
– Use low-sodium broth to control salt levels.
– Always taste and adjust seasoning before serving.
– Don’t add cream too early; it should be added at the end to prevent curdling.

FAQs
What is Zuppa Toscana made of?
Zuppa Toscana is traditionally made with Italian sausage, kale, potatoes, and a creamy broth. It’s a hearty soup that reflects the flavors of Tuscany.
Can I make Zuppa Toscana ahead of time?
Yes, you can prepare Zuppa Toscana ahead of time. The flavors develop even more when allowed to sit, making it a great dish for meal prep.
Is Zuppa Toscana spicy?
The spice level depends on the type of sausage used. Spicy Italian sausage will add heat, while mild sausage will keep it gentle. Adjust according to your preference.
How can I make Zuppa Toscana healthier?
To make it healthier, use turkey sausage, reduce the cream, or substitute it with a lower-fat alternative. Adding more vegetables can also enhance its nutrition.
Can I freeze Zuppa Toscana?
Yes, Zuppa Toscana can be frozen. However, keep in mind that the cream may separate upon reheating. It’s best to freeze it without the cream added.
